The Boeing Company is seeking a Mid

- Level Greenhouse Gas (GHG) Sustainability Strategy Analyst located in Hazelwood, MO or Tukwila, WA, United States to join our Global Sustainability Reporting and Governance team within Global Enterprise Sustainability (GES). This team contributes to public policy development globally, prepares sustainability reports aligned to various global requirements (e.g. California SB261, CSRD, ISSB, etc.), and manages compliance, operational and strategic risks for the GES organization.

This role supports global greenhouse gas strategy, activity data collection and annual GHG calculations to meet the Company's various global requirements. The successful candidate will help develop and execute strategies so the reporting team meets GHG regulatory requirements and is prepared for emerging assurance requirements related to Boeing's GHG inventory system and processes. Integration of GHG standards, policy positions and advocacy strategies globally is also an expected part of the role.

You will be asked to support annual process improvement initiatives for GHG reporting, contribute to GHG assurance readiness efforts, and support the global GHG activity data collection process. This includes partnering with adjacent functions such as Environment, Health and Safety (EHS), Global Real Estate & Facilities (GREF), and Boeing Global Enterprise Services (BGES) on activity data that directly supports our GHG inventory calculations. You will directly support GHG calculations for Boeing and its subsidiaries, ensure alignment with the Greenhouse Gas Protocol (GHGP) and other regulatory standards, support advocacy on emerging GHG standards, and assist with Enablon system updates to improve GHG collection and calculation processes.

Critical skills and requirements include a proven track record of managing complex, cross-functional projects in matrixed organizations; experience with GHG data collection, aggregation and calculations; and knowledge and experience with Greenhouse Gas Protocol Corporate Standard methodology. Experience with Enablon and an understanding of its usage in GHG collection and calculation processes is required. Effective written and verbal communication skills are necessary — the role specifies being fluent in both written and verbal English. Candidates must have high attention to detail, an analytical mindset, and a proactive approach to problem-solving, plus the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ment through proactive collaboration. The role requires the ability to work across multiple time zones — most notably the United States, Australia, United Kingdom, and the European Union — and the proven ability to engage multiple internal stakeholders to drive involvement and collaboration through influence. Proficiency with MS Office suite, project and data management tools is expected.
